I am building a small 20' inground round pool with a 2' platform on one side and a 3' platform on the other with a depth of 52", planning on running a variable speed pump 24/7 with a SWG and Heat Pump. My pool designer has never done a pool without main drain but with what I have been reading on the forum lately it really seems like I don't need one and it would be great to avoid another potential leak point in the liner and future problems down the road. I also feel like with this size of pool I could get away with using a single skimmer since it will be covered and not near any trees or anything. Water level dropping isn't much of a concern since it is something we pay attention to and when we leave for an extended period we plan to cover the pool and run a hose from the skimmer down into the water as a safety precaution since the skimmer won't be doing anything anyway with a cover on.

Assuming the returns are placed properly to create a good flow do you guys think I will be fine with a single skimmer and no main drain?
 
How many returns do you have in your pool?
Six. I was fortunately my pool installer gave me that much. Many others with a pool around my size only see to have 4, some less. 4 of my jets are directly across from the skimmer on the long end, and two jets are near the shallow bench areas off to the side.

Biggest thing - Be mindful of your prevailing wind direction for skimmer placement. You could have 20 jets in the pool and they won't push debris into the skimmer if the wind pushes away from the skimmer.
